Ungdomsfält Malmö (Youth Field Malmö) works with outreach and preventive measures for children and young people in various environments across the city. With the new Social Services Act, this approach is further strengthened, and the operation is now in a development phase. Therefore, we are recruiting more colleagues who wish to contribute to early and relationship-building work for young people in Malmö.

Job Description

Ungdomsfält Malmö is looking for more colleagues who can meet young people moving around the city in the evenings, nights, and on weekends. We work preventively with young people aged 12–21, focusing on those at risk of crime, substance abuse, or other behaviors that may hinder positive development. The Youth Field is divided into four geographical areas, with four staff members in each team.

You will work out in the field, with the majority of the work done on foot. You will engage in relationship-building with young people and their parents, both outdoors in the field, on social media, or by phone. You will identify young people at risk who can be referred to appropriate support services if needed. You will collaborate regularly with the police, schools, other units within social services, civil society, and other actors working with young people in the city.

The crime and drug prevention work is carried out from a clear authority role. The assignment also includes work at various large events for young people.

Youth Field operates based on various conversation models, including MI (Motivational Interviewing), and you will have the opportunity to develop your skills in conversations and methods for outreach and relationship-building work. We work regularly with feedback, various method developments, and provide supervision within the teams. Youth Field Malmö is also part of Malmö City's crisis support organization and can be activated as crisis supporters during special events during working hours. These events can vary and require flexibility and psychological stability.

As an employer, we actively and systematically work for a safe and secure working environment. This means clear routines, team work, support from colleagues and managers, and a continuous focus on safety and security in field work.

About the Workplace

Ungdomsfält Malmö consists of 18 employees and is led by two section managers in a shared leadership model. Youth Field is a separate section within Social Services' Individual and Family Care, Department Intervention, Unit for Prevention and Early Support.
